UIS to offer ASL concentration

Thanks to a $30,000 gift from Springfield attorney Joe Gibbs and his wife, Lynn, UIS will offer a concentration in American Sign Language beginning in the 2008 spring semester. The Gibbses provided funding for first-year development and implementation of the concentration, to be offered by the Teacher Education Program.
